Transaction 40ce5366dc8f20d78a3198949dd77a9174ffe3a7e8a1a911f00b9690537b8c60
3 Input
2 Outputs
- 40ce5366dc8f20d78a3198949dd77a9174ffe3a7e8a1a911f00b9690537b8c60:0
- 40ce5366dc8f20d78a3198949dd77a9174ffe3a7e8a1a911f00b9690537b8c60:1
value 20475
address 16FsmLSyNCxUDRBHR2KqN31tFSQhskNQHj
value 2565000
address 32ZGUqe538sqKPmVhL3bWc5CMoCzyBbpSd